Output 6ef53319ddaf4e9e86b4574dca86391069bd8886a3a4fcdd2d232c3ae08ee85e:0

value
15888
script pubkey
OP_0 OP_PUSHBYTES_20 cc8d6a5df654e8a5384092a768c60beb33cc8635
address
bc1qejxk5h0k2n522wzqj2nk33staveuep34hq2vv3
transaction
6ef53319ddaf4e9e86b4574dca86391069bd8886a3a4fcdd2d232c3ae08ee85e
confirmations
150604
spent
true